David seal arm architecture reference manual, 2001 addison wesley, england. Cortexm microcontrollers in assembly language and c embedded systems with arm cortexm3. Download embedded systems with arm cortexm microcontrollers. Get free access to pdf ebook embedded systems with arm cortex m3 fundamentals of embedded software with. Embedded systems with arm cortex m3 microcontrollers in assembly. Embedded systems, realtime interfacing to arm cortexm microcontrollers 2016, isbn. Embedded systems realtime interfacing to the arm cortex m3, jonathan w. Realtime interfacing to armr cortextmm microcontrollers for. Real time interfacing to arm cortex m microcontrollers, focuses on hardwaresoftware interfacing and the design of embedded systems.
This fourth edition includes the new tm4c1294based launchpad. Embedded systems, microcontrollers and arm request pdf. Particularly arm cortex m3 will be studied as a representative embedded processor. Real time interfacing to arm cortex m microcontrollers 9781463590154 by valvano, jonathan w. About for books embedded systems with arm cortexm3. Embedded systems hardware for software engineers describes the electrical and electronic circuits that are used in embedded systems, their functions, and how they can be interfaced to other devices. Real time operating systems for arm cortex m microcontrollers is an advanced book. Embedded system design, analysis and optimization creating responsive multithreaded systems optimizing code speed optimizing system power and energy optimizing memory requirements details in appendix. There are also msp432 versions of the first two volumes. Real time interfacing to arm cortex m microcontrollers focuses on interfacing and the design of embedded systems. An embedded system is a system that performs a specific task and has a computer embedded inside. Realtime interfacing to arm cortexm microcontroller focuses on interfacing and the design of embedded systems.
Embeddedreal time systems concepts, design and programming black book, prasad, kvk. Arm and uvision are registered trademarks of arm limited. This third book is an advanced book focusing on operating systems, highspeed interfacing, control systems, bluetooth, and robotics. This first book is an introduction to computers and interfacing focusing on assembly language and c programming. Introduction to arm cortexm3 microcontrollers, 2012 chapter 8 lecture.
Realtime interfacing to arm cortexm microcontrollers focuses on interfacing and the design of embedded systems. Realtime interfacing to the arm cortexm3 this book is the second in a series of three books that teach the fundamentals of embedded systems as applied to the arm cortexm3. Basic computer architecture topics, memory, address decoding techniques, rom, ram, dram, ddr, cache memory, and memory hierarchy are discussed. Real time operating systems for arm cortex m microcontrollers is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ics. The book introduces basic programming of arm cortex m cores in assembly and c at the register level, and the fundamentals of embedded system design. Embedded systems, realtime operating systems for arm cortexm microcontrollers 2017, isbn. Pdf download embedded systems with arm cortexm3 microcontrollers in assembly language and. Introduction to arm cortex m3 microcontrollers, 2012 chapter 8 lecture. Embedded systems with arm cortexm microcontrollers in. Most of the code in the book is specific for the tm4c123based launchpad. It presents basic concepts such as data representations integer, fixedpoint, floatingpoint, assembly instructions, stack, and implementing basic controls and functions of c language at the. Realtime operating systems ee445m volume 3 seniorgrad ee. Intro to arm cortexm3 processor and lpc1768 microcontroller, notes 1. Realtime interfacing to the msp432 microcontroller focuses on hardwaresoftware interfacing and the design of embedded systems.
Ti university program educators microcontrollers mcu. Introduction to arm cortex m microcontrollers by jonathan w. Realtime interfacing to arma cortextmm microcontrollers embedded systems introduction to arm\xae cortex\u2122m microcontrollers designing embedded systems with pic microcontrollers, 2nd. Introduction to the arm cortexm3 is an introduction to computers and interfacing focusing on assembly language and c programming. Further, they not only understood the importance of rtos and tools.
By the end of the course, you should be able to understand the big ideas in embedded systems obtain direct handson experience on both hardware and software elements. Embedded systems with arm cortexm microcontrollers in assembly language and c third edition isbn. It also covers the detailed programming of interrupts, adc, dac, and timer features of atmel arm sam d21 chip. Real time interfacing to arm cortex m microcontrollers focuses on hardwaresoftware interfacing and the design of embedded systems.
Microcontrollers, fifth edition volume 1 embedded systems. The three books are primarily written for undergraduate electrical and computer engineering students. Request pdf on dec 31, 2012, rob toulson and others published embedded systems, microcontrollers and arm find, read and cite all the research you need on researchgate. Realtime operating pdf systems for arm cortexm microcontrollers is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ics. The book introduces basic programming of arm cortexm cores in assembly and c at the register level, and the fundamentals of embedded system design. Embedded systems programming on arm cortexm3 m4 processor. Jul 25, 2018 the book also covers many advanced components of embedded systems, such as software and hardware interrupts, general purpose io, lcd driver, keypad interaction, real time clock, stepper motor control, pwm input and output, digital input capture, direct memory access dma, digital and analog conversion, and serial communication usart, i2c. Teaching embedded system design and optimization with the arm. Everyday low prices and free delivery on eligible orders. Realtime interfacing to arm cortex microcontrollers, volume 2, 2012 ch. Freescale embedded solutions based on arm technology.
Embedded processing with the arm cortex a9 on the xilinx zynq7000 all programmable soc ti msp432 arm programming for embedded systems. Real time interfacing to arm cortex m microcontroller focuses on interfacing and the design of embedded systems. Jonathan valvano university of texas at austin valvano. Obtain handson experience in programming embedded systems. Students are introduced to software development concepts applicable to realtime and embedded systems.
Realtime interfacing to arm cortexm microcontrollers 9781463590154 by valvano, jonathan w. Embedded systems rely on both mcu hardware peripherals and. Embedded systems real time operating systems for the. Embedded systems with arm cortex m microcontrollers in assembly language and c third edition isbn. Embedded system design, analysis and optimization creating responsive multithreaded systems. Definitive guide to the arm cortexm3 electrical engineering. Realtime operating systems for arm cortexm microcontrollers, is an advanced book focusing on operating systems.
Embedded systems real time operating systems for the arm. Realtime interfacing to the arm cortexm3 focuses on interfacing and the design of embedded systems. Systems with arm cortex m3 microcontrollers in assembly language and c embedded systems. This third book is an advanced book focusing on operating systems, highspeed interfacing, control systems, robotics, bluetooth, and the internet of things iot.
The third volume could also be used for professionals wishing to design or deploy a realtime operating system onto an arm platform. The third volume could also be used for professionals wishing to design or deploy a real time operating system onto an arm platform. Analysis and valuation, risk management, and the future of energy by betty simkins, russell simkins. Stm32l152xx arm cortex m3 microcontroller reference manual. This first book is an introductory book that could be used at the. The cortexm3 processor is the first arm processor based on the armv7m architecture and has been specifically designed to achieve high system performance in power and costsensitive embedded applications, such as microcontrollers, automotive body systems, industrial control. Embedded processing with the arm cortexa9 on the xilinx zynq7000 all programmable soc ti msp432 arm programming for embedded systems. Realtime operating systems for arm cortex m microcontrollerscreatespace independent publishing platform 2012. Teaching embedded system design and optimization with the. Embedded systems with arm cortex m3 microcontrollers in assembly language and c keywords.
Intro to arm cortexm3 processor and lpc1768 microcontroller, readings. It provides the advance knowledge required for embedded computer design and development as well as realtime operating systems. Embedded systems with arm cortexm3 microcontrollers in. Real time interfacing to the msp432 microcontroller focuses on hardwaresoftware interfacing and the design of embedded systems. The cortex m3 processor is the first arm processor based on the armv7m architecture and has been specifically designed to achieve high system performance in power and costsensitive. Real time operating systems for arm cortex m microcontrollers embedded systems introduction to arm \xae cortex \u2122m microcontrollers ti msp432 arm programming for embedded. Realtime operating systems for arm cortexm microcontrollers, is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ics. This second book focuses on interfacing and systemlevel design.
Systems with arm cortexm3 microcontrollers in assembly language and c embedded systems. Embedded systems realtime interfacing to the arm cortex m3. Understand the scientific principles and concepts behind embedded systems, and 2. Monday and wednesday 1112 and by appointment instructor. Realtime interfacing to arm cortexm microcontrollers, focuses on hardwaresoftware interfacing and the design of embedded systems. Realtime interfacing to arm cortextmm microcontrollers by jonathan w. Realtime operating systems for arm cortex m microcontrollers embedded systems introduction to arm\xae cortex\u2122m microcontrollers ti msp432 arm programming for embedded.
Embedded systems programming on arm cortexm3m4 processor 4. Embedded software in c for an arm cortex m by jonathan valvano and ramesh yerraballi is licensed under a creative commons attributionnoncommercialnoderivatives 4. Introduction to arm cortex m3 microcontrollers, 2012 chapter 10. Realtime operating systems for arm cortexm microcontrollers is an advanced book. Realtime trace on devices based on cortexm3 and m4. Real time operating systems for arm cortex m microcontrollers, is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ics. Realtime interfacing to arm cortex microcontrollers, volume 2. Real time operating pdf systems for arm cortex m microcontrollers is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ics.
This collision system is intended to perform the detection of the accident and to release of air bag in the time of accident by using adxl sensor, gsm and gps modules duly interfacing with arm processor. Lpc1768 arm cortex m3 svsembedded systems coursehobby learningdevelopment kit introduction to c. Realtime operating systems for arm cortexm microcontrollers is an advanced book focusing on operating systems, highspeed interfacing, control systems, and robotics. Requires free registration to download pdf 1020 pages, browse it only. Realtime interfacing to arm cortextmm microcontrollers volume 2 fourth edition, june 2014 jonathan w. This third book is an advanced book focusing on operating systems, highspeed interfacing, control systems, robotics, bluetooth, and the internet of. About for books embedded systems with arm cortexm3 microcontrollers in assembly language and c. Realtime interfacing to arm cortexm microcontrollers focuses on hardwaresoftware interfacing and the design of embedded systems.
784 805 685 701 1472 304 808 950 446 1344 863 1163 149 650 1501 473 831 1573 35 406 458 1090 910 847 1047 958 1148 58 972 503